What changed here
DerivedThe seat changed hands: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am (DMK) lost it to Indian National Congress (INC), which now leads by 3.1%.
Boundaries were redrawn between 1971 and 1977 — the comparison is matched by name and is indicative only.
- INC vote shareINC went from 0.0% to 50.8% of the vote here (+50.8%).
- TurnoutTurnout fell 7.7% to 58.0%.
